Sparrow Salvage

Sparrow Salvage specializes in Neo-Victorian jewelry with a “post-apocalyptic edge.” The clever creator of this line calls it “Faginpunk.” All of the items are made by hand using antique and vintage textiles.

Dust Design Co.

Dropping new items weekly, Dust Design Co searches out objects that would be considered “obsolete,” and puts them to good use. Great items for both men and women!

QA Create

QA Create specializes in specific, niche, artisan made jewelry. Their concept is to recycle “lost and forgotten” items into something fashionable. All items are 100% handmade.

19 Moons

19 Moons is a limited edition jewelry shop that makes its one of a kind pieces out of vintage and recycled materials. Sticking to a Steampunk, Neo-Victorian, Industrial, and Retro style, this shop is a great find for unique finds for both men and women.
